Brilliant PR & Marketing, one of the most respected and rapidly growing agencies focused on family-oriented brands, seeks a Full-time Social Media Content Coordinator to help support the agency’s growing, award-winning team.Who We Are:So what’s Brilliant all about? We are a unique PR agency with nearly 30 team members who all work remotely across the US. We give our team the resources they need to get their work done without having to sit in a cubicle or stuffy office. From costume contests to virtual happy hours and Slack GIFs, we prioritize connecting with each other and creating a sense of community. Although we are remote, team members are expected to be available online during regular business hours, and there is occasional travel for events and trade shows. If applicable, this role of Social Media Content Coordinator will allow for adjusted working hours for being a parent.What We Do:Brilliant is in its second decade as a fully remote company and is one of the most respected agencies serving consumer lifestyle brands with a specific focus on products, brands, and services for families including baby and maternity, toys and games, tech, housewares, and food.What We’re Looking For:Our Dream Team Member:Has experience creating content and managing a content calendar for family oriented
brandsUp to date on pop culture, parenting hacks and trends.Ability to understand historical, current, and future trends in the digital content and social media spaceFamiliarity and regular user of all social media platforms, with a strong knowledge of TikTok, Instagram, Facebook, Pinterest, and YouTubeHas experience with late night infant feedings with sleep deprivation, stepping on legos and multitasking childcare management while juggling a career.Resourceful, committed, and deliberateHas a test & learn mentality. Actively participates in brainstorms and isn’t afraid to speak up and offer new ideas.Creative, witty writer who is a passionate strategic thinker excited about helping clients increase brand awareness through the use of organic social.Core Skills/Qualifications:Fluent in all social media platforms and familiar with social media management tools like Later, Sprout Social, Hootsuite or similar.Proficient in Canva or equivalent video and photo editing tools and digital media formats.Strong copywriting and copy editing skillsTop-notch oral and verbal communication skillsImpeccable time management skills with the ability to multitaskDetail-oriented approach with ability to work under pressure to meet deadlinesJob Description:Assist in the development and management of a results-driven social media strategy focusing on building audience and extending brand engagement, ultimately building brand equity.Collaborate with the PR, Influencer & Marketing teams to create a brand relevant social media calendar.Test and learn different messaging, tactics and strategies while staying up to date on new social media tools and best practices, competitive activity and industry approaches to the channels.Develop and curate engaging written, video, and photo content for social media platforms.Lead the day-to-day community management, specifically publishing and engagement, of all assigned client social media accounts.Publish monthly reports detailing social analytics across all assigned client channels including recommendations for improvement and action plans.Comfortable being the day-to-day client point of contactBenefits Eligible For:PTO (Paid Time Off)Paid time off between Christmas and New Year'sFabulous Fridays - work day ends at 12 pm between Memorial Day and Labor Day and 3 pm for the remainder of the year401K with a 3% company matchMedical, dental, and vision coverageMedical and Dependent Care FSALife InsuranceLong Term DisabilityAccess to Short Term Disability, Hospital, and Critical Illness InsurancesPet insuranceSalary: Depends on experience, skills and working hours. $45,000-$65,000 Annually
